    Default Toads and Frogs in the same habitat?

    So i was wondering if toads and frogs can be housed in the same habitat? I do not have a frog yet but i would like to catch one this summer and i only have the one tank. If they can be housed together what do i need?

    Default Re: Toads and Frogs in the same habitat?

    Frogs and toads all release toxic skin secretions of various degrees, and housing different species in a tank together can be potentially hazardous. Additionally, our native toads are also essentially terrestrial while our native frogs are largely aquatic (if it's a Ranid you're looking to get) and thus have rather different housing requirements.

    The safest option is always separate tanks for different species. This goes double (or triple) for anyone new to keeping frogs.

    Default Re: Toads and Frogs in the same habitat?

    Please follow Brian's suggestions. As a rule of thumb, you'd almost never different frog and toad species together. I would even go as far as not to house more than one individual per tank. One reason is that the bigger one will eat the smaller one if they're house in the same habitat. Most amphibians are not discriminate eaters as they will eat whatever that fits in their mouths. And two, like Brian said, amphibians are likely toxic so if they eat each other they will all ended up dying. Three, housing multiple amphibians may risk disease transmission, especially with wild caught animals. If you had previously kept amphibian in your tank, I would suggest to decontaminate before you put a new animal in it by rinsing it with diluted bleach (in a ratio of 1 part bleach per 10 parts water).
